About St. Hubertusstraat 4, Helmond
At €260,000, this apartment is the cheapest of the 14 homes currently for sale in Heipoort. The average asking price in the neighbourhood is €409,643, so this listing sits 37% below that. However, the floor area of 45 m² is 66% smaller than the neighbourhood average of 132 m², so the price reflects the compact size.
Heipoort is described by a resident as a 'cosy and quiet' neighbourhood where people get along well. It's densely populated with a mix of ages, including many families and singles. The area has a strong community feel, and the single review gives it a score of 9.63 out of 10.
The nearest train station is 1.3 km away, which is about a 15-minute walk or a short cycle ride.
An AH XL is just 366 metres away, a Lidl is 439 metres, and Zapolski is 518 metres. For daily groceries, you have several options within a few minutes' walk.
Vrijeschool Peelland primary school is 378 metres away, and Vakcollege Helmond secondary school is 387 metres. There are also several other schools within walking distance.
The energy label is B, which means the home is reasonably energy-efficient. You can expect moderate energy costs, though not as low as a modern A+ property.
